blob: 5b1707fd2f23e2bf2b3ed4093582c96bfd94e9d5 [file] [log] [blame]
<!-- Based on fast/repaint/hover-pseudo-borders-whitespace.html -->
<!doctype html>
<style>
div {
width: 100px;
height: 100px;
}
#div_border {
border: 10px solid;
}
#div_outline {
outline: 10px solid;
margin: 20px 0 0 10px;
}
#div_border:hover, #div_border:hover + #div_outline {
color: green;
}
</style>
<script src="resources/paint-invalidation-test.js"></script>
<script>
window.expectedPaintInvalidationObjects = [
"LayoutBlockFlow DIV id='div_border'",
"LayoutBlockFlow DIV id='div_outline'",
];
function paintInvalidationTest() {
if (!window.testRunner)
return;
eventSender.mouseMoveTo(50, 50);
}
window.addEventListener("load", runPaintInvalidationTest);
</script>
<div id="div_border"></div>
<div id="div_outline"></div>